BACOLOD City generates P4.2 billion annually from the sugarcane industry, lucrative tourism sector, and real estate, making significant contributions to the local economy.

The sugarcane industry in Bacolod City has been a key component of its economy, with large plantations yielding quality sugar that is sought after both locally and internationally.
